Family carers in Europe today: state of play

European Round Table

When? 24th October 2024, from 9.00-12.00
Where? European Committee of the Regions, Room JDE51, 99-101 Rue Belliard, 1040 Brussels, Belgium


Background


In the run-up to the 29th October UN international day of care and support, this European round table co-hosted by COFACE Disability and the European Committee of the Regions, fostered debate on the realities and support needs of family carers in the European Union today. It shed light on the role of European frameworks to support families with disabilities and/or in need of care through robust community-based intervention models at the local and regional levels.

It is on this occasion that COFACE Disability launched its reviewed European Charter for Family Carers, available in English and French, and Easy-to-read in English. See here.
